There are a couple of weird issues with the brake light inside the cluster inside my 1994 Accord Ex.

1. A couple of days ago the brake light started coming on (and staying on) when the car is in D4, D3, D2 or R. The brake light goes off as soon I shift back into P or N. I checked the fluid and it seems to be ok, so are the pads - replaced maybe 6 months ago. Any ideas of what this could be and where else I could look?

2. This problem preceded the one in #1 (ie it was happening before the light started coming on solid when the car is in any moving gear). After driving for a while (usually over an hour), the brake light would slowly light up (never fully lit, but progressed from being barely visibile to dimly lit). It would go away after the car would sit for a while, but always came back on after driving for a period of time.

Could these two be related, and if anyone knows what could be the causes of each?

Ok so the pesky e-brake light is back and won't go away. I replaced the top of the reservoir cap/floater and bled the whole system - the light still will not go away.

One thing I noticed - the light only comes on when the car is in moving gear (i.e. not in park or neutral). However, the light also stays off if any door of the car is open (even with the car in D or R).

RESOLVED: turns out there was a break in the wiring of the alarm system on the car, and a ground wire was loose. I reattached it and the light is gone!!
